How much electricity does geothermal energy generate?

Geothermal energy currently generates about 17.5 gigawatts worldwide, with the potential to generate much more with further development. The amount of electricity generated depends on factors such as the size and efficiency of the geothermal power plant, as well as the heat resources available.


Is fuel needed to get geothermal energy?

Geothermal energy, such as hot springs, is used to heat home and factories so in this sense geothermal energy is fuel. However to create a system that uses geothermal needs an infrastucture which needs to be designed and built, in this sense geothermal energy needs an energy input.


What is energy from hot magma called?

Energy from hot magma is called geothermal energy. This energy is harnessed through the use of geothermal power plants to generate electricity or for direct heating applications.


What are the primary consumers of geothermal energy?

The primary consumers of geothermal energy are residential, commercial, and industrial buildings for heating and cooling purposes. Geothermal power plants also utilize this energy source to generate electricity.

Is geothermal energy renewable nonrenewable or inexhaustible?

Geothermal energy is considered renewable because it is derived from the heat within the Earth's crust. As long as the Earth's core continues to generate heat, geothermal energy will be replenished.


How much can geothermal energy produce?

Geothermal energy has the potential to generate a significant amount of electricity. The estimated global potential for geothermal power generation is around 35 gigawatts (GW), but this can vary depending on the location and technological advancements. Currently, geothermal power plants worldwide supply about 14 GW of electricity.
